Transaction d71fecaea92002614c18c33d58efecfb8d73cae46e1bd9a250c6b41d31aafe2d

1 Input
2 Outputs
  • d71fecaea92002614c18c33d58efecfb8d73cae46e1bd9a250c6b41d31aafe2d:0
  • value  85604712
    address  18Di5KJVro5bbA66WdDJ3qSLLzsgzahRuY
  • d71fecaea92002614c18c33d58efecfb8d73cae46e1bd9a250c6b41d31aafe2d:1
  • value  2559874038
    address  1AssNnBcJ2tuwH4yD2JycNorSLDYm3NC3A